The Russian-Ukrainian conflict is still continuing, and the United States may directly participate in the war? Ukrainian has listed a list of weapons to the United States, including some offensive weapons that can directly attack Russia's mainland. In response, the Russian ambassador to the United States bluntly warned and drew a red line against the United States.

According to Global Network , some US media recently revealed that the list of weapons demands proposed by Ukraine to the United States includes dozens of offensive weapon systems, among which the "Army Tactical Missile System" (ATACMS) can be launched through the "Haimas" system and has a range of 300 kilometers has attracted much attention. US media said that there are 29 weapon systems on the list compiled by Ukraine called "Occurrence Operations", including the "Army Tactical Missile System" missile, the "Haimas" multi-barrel rocket launcher system, the tank , drones, the artillery system, the "Harpoon" anti-ship missile and 2,000 rocket launcher shells.

Military expert Zhang Xuefeng pointed out that the latest model of the "Army Tactical Missile System" missile has a range of about 300 kilometers. If the United States really provides Ukraine with such a missile, Ukraine can strike some important targets in the depth of the battle that originally could not be hit by the "Haimas" guided rockets, which will bring greater trouble and difficulties to the Russian army. For example, air force bases, high-level command posts, and large ammunition depots, , may all become the targets of Ukraine's attack. Obviously, Russia must strongly oppose this.

On September 14th local time, Russian Ambassador to the United States Antonov issued a warning in an interview that if Ukraine obtains long-range missile and attacks Russia's mainland, the United States will be involved in a direct military confrontation with Russia. Antonov particularly emphasized that I have noticed that Ukraine seeks missiles provided by the United States to strike targets 300 kilometers away. If Kiev obtains this weapon, Russia's big cities and industrial and transportation infrastructure will become areas that may be destroyed, and this situation will mean that the United States is directly involved in a military confrontation with Russia.

It is worth mentioning that some US media said that the Ukrainian government requested the US to provide "army tactical missile system" missiles, and the US Department of Defense is worried that the Ukrainian army may use these equipment to strike Russia's mainland and escalate the conflict. Zhang Xuefeng also believes that Ukraine has requested the United States many times to provide relevant missiles, but the United States has never provided them. Because this kind of missile is relatively expensive, even if the United States provides it to Ukraine in the future, it may provide earlier and closer versions, and the number will not be too large. Even so, given that Kiev is obtaining more and more destructive weapons from Western sponsors, some Russian media believe that the possibility that the United States will also provide long-range missiles for the "Haimas" system cannot be completely ruled out. After all, the United States has provided Ukraine with high-precision 155mm shells used in the M777 and M109 howitzers.

In response to the fact that the United States and the West are still providing military aid to Ukraine continuously, Antonov also said in an interview on the 14th that American arms dealers have been making a fortune in war, and this can be confirmed by World War and World War II . A similar situation is happening now, with millions of shells and a large number of weapons produced by the United States being continuously transported to the Ukrainian frontline. The Western bosses behind Kiev will not agree to a peaceful resolution of the Russian-Ukrainian conflict, and they will continue to push the conflict to a new round of "suicide adventure."

Antonov bluntly stated that the United States is making every effort to turn Ukraine into a training ground for dealing with outdated NATO weapons and testing new NATO weapons against Russian weapons. The patron behind Kiev is “desire for power and money” and is not interested in a peaceful solution. The West has hardly discussed negotiations, only about shipping more weapons to Ukraine. Once again, the statements of U.S. government representatives about their failure to participate in the Ukrainian conflict are absurd and untenable.
